| class CollectionTransformer extends Transformer { |
| final CoreTypes coreTypes; |
| final Procedure listAdd; |
| final Procedure setFactory; |
| final Procedure setAdd; |
| final Procedure objectEquals; |
| final Procedure mapEntries; |
| final Procedure mapPut; |
| final Class mapEntryClass; |
| final Field mapEntryKey; |
| final Field mapEntryValue; |
| |
| static Procedure _findSetFactory(CoreTypes coreTypes) { |
| Procedure factory = coreTypes.index.getMember('dart:core', 'Set', ''); |
| RedirectingFactoryBody body = factory?.function?.body; |
| return body?.target; |
| } |
| |
| CollectionTransformer(SourceLoader loader) |
| : coreTypes = loader.coreTypes, |
| listAdd = loader.coreTypes.index.getMember('dart:core', 'List', 'add'), |
| setFactory = _findSetFactory(loader.coreTypes), |
| setAdd = loader.coreTypes.index.getMember('dart:core', 'Set', 'add'), |
| objectEquals = |
| loader.coreTypes.index.getMember('dart:core', 'Object', '=='), |
| mapEntries = |
| loader.coreTypes.index.getMember('dart:core', 'Map', 'get:entries'), |
| mapPut = loader.coreTypes.index.getMember('dart:core', 'Map', '[]='), |
| mapEntryClass = |
| loader.coreTypes.index.getClass('dart:core', 'MapEntry'), |
| mapEntryKey = |
| loader.coreTypes.index.getMember('dart:core', 'MapEntry', 'key'), |
| mapEntryValue = |
| loader.coreTypes.index.getMember('dart:core', 'MapEntry', 'value'); |
| |
| TreeNode _translateListOrSet( |
| Expression node, DartType elementType, List<Expression> elements, |
| {bool isSet: false, bool isConst: false}) { |
| // Translate elements in place up to the first spread if any. |
| int i = 0; |
| for (; i < elements.length; ++i) { |
| if (elements[i] is SpreadElement) break; |
| elements[i] = elements[i].accept(this)..parent = node; |
| } |
| |
| // If there was no spread, we are done. |
| if (i == elements.length) return node; |
| |
| if (isConst) { |
| // We don't desugar const lists here. Remove spread for now so that they |
| // don't leak out. |
| for (; i < elements.length; ++i) { |
| Expression element = elements[i]; |
| if (element is SpreadElement) { |
| elements[i] = InvalidExpression('unimplemented spread element') |
| ..fileOffset = element.fileOffset |
| ..parent = node; |
| } else { |
| elements[i] = element.accept(this)..parent = node; |
| } |
| } |
| return node; |
| } |
| |
| // Build a block expression and create an empty list or set. |
| VariableDeclaration result; |
| if (isSet) { |
| // TODO(kmillikin): When all the back ends handle set literals we can use |
| // one here. |
| result = new VariableDeclaration.forValue( |
| new StaticInvocation( |
| setFactory, new Arguments([], types: [elementType])), |
| type: new InterfaceType(coreTypes.setClass, [elementType]), |
| isFinal: true); |
| } else { |
| result = new VariableDeclaration.forValue( |
| new ListLiteral([], typeArgument: elementType), |
| type: new InterfaceType(coreTypes.listClass, [elementType]), |
| isFinal: true); |
| } |
| List<Statement> body = [result]; |
| // Add the elements up to the first spread. |
| for (int j = 0; j < i; ++j) { |
| body.add(new ExpressionStatement(new MethodInvocation( |
| new VariableGet(result), |
| new Name('add'), |
| new Arguments([elements[j]]), |
| isSet ? setAdd : listAdd))); |
| } |
| // Translate the elements starting with the first spread. |
| for (; i < elements.length; ++i) { |
| Expression element = elements[i]; |
| if (element is SpreadElement) { |
| Expression value = element.expression.accept(this); |
| // Null-aware spreads require testing the subexpression's value. |
| VariableDeclaration temp; |
| if (element.isNullAware) { |
| temp = new VariableDeclaration.forValue(value, |
| type: const DynamicType(), isFinal: true); |
| body.add(temp); |
| value = new VariableGet(temp); |
| } |
| |
| VariableDeclaration elt = |
| new VariableDeclaration(null, type: elementType, isFinal: true); |
| Statement statement = new ForInStatement( |
| elt, |
| value, |
| new ExpressionStatement(new MethodInvocation( |
| new VariableGet(result), |
| new Name('add'), |
| new Arguments([new VariableGet(elt)]), |
| isSet ? setAdd : listAdd))); |
| |
| if (element.isNullAware) { |
| statement = new IfStatement( |
| new Not(new MethodInvocation( |
| new VariableGet(temp), |
| new Name('=='), |
| new Arguments([new NullLiteral()]), |
| objectEquals)), |
| statement, |
| null); |
| } |
| body.add(statement); |
| } else { |
| body.add(new ExpressionStatement(new MethodInvocation( |
| new VariableGet(result), |
| new Name('add'), |
| new Arguments([element.accept(this)]), |
| isSet ? setAdd : listAdd))); |
| } |
| } |
| |
| return new BlockExpression(new Block(body), new VariableGet(result)); |
| } |
| |
| @override |
| TreeNode visitListLiteral(ListLiteral node) { |
| return _translateListOrSet(node, node.typeArgument, node.expressions, |
| isConst: node.isConst, isSet: false); |
| } |
| |
| @override |
| TreeNode visitSetLiteral(SetLiteral node) { |
| return _translateListOrSet(node, node.typeArgument, node.expressions, |
| isConst: node.isConst, isSet: true); |
| } |
